Along with all of the special vehicles within the Nissan display itself, two customized 2017 Rogue vehicles greet attendees as they walk into the South Atrium of the Los Angeles Convention Center where the show is being held. The first of these vehicles is an X-wing-inspired Rogue, complete with thrusters, blasters, side mirror Rebel logo projectors and an astromech droid. The second custom Rogue is inspired by an X-wing pilot jump suit and is wrapped in special orange and white graphics and logos. Both custom vehicles are surrounded by Star Wars-themed, innovative consumer engagement platforms. These custom vehicles will not be offered for sale. The Nissan Virtual Reality Experience offers three ways to create a new perspective within the display including: ◾The Nissan Rogue Studio Augmented Reality (AR) kiosk that places the user and a Nissan Rogue into a virtual battle test simulator that overlays AR content onto a live-video capture. Users then receive the video composition on their smartphone to save and share. ◾The Digital Mirror Experience allows up to two people at a time to stand in front of large LED screens and be transformed into stormtroopers or Nissan Rogue-inspired robots. At the end of the interaction, they will receive their photo to save and share. ◾And, a preview of the to-be-released Battle Test, A Nissan Rogue virtual reality (VR) experience, which will demonstrate the new 2017 Rogue SUV's Intelligent Safety Shield technologies from every direction. Leaving the world of virtual reality to actual reality, special appearances in the Nissan display by Star Wars stormtroopers are scheduled to appear all-day during the weekends of Nov. 19-20 and Nov. 26-27. Also, a variety of costumes from the movie, including shoretrooper and Rebel Alliance SpecForces, are on display – along with an exclusive Death Trooper helmet replica. In addition, the Costume and Model Gallery will display scale models of the Y-wing, AT-ACT, X-wing and TIE Striker. About Nissan Rogue The Nissan Rogue, marching its way to the top-selling spot in the Nissan lineup, has been updated for the 2017 model year with fresh exterior and interior treatments, an expanded suite of Nissan Safety Shield technology including available Forward Emergency Braking with Pedestrian Detection*, and the first ever Rogue Hybrid model. About 'Rogue One: A Star Wars Story' From Lucasfilm comes the first of the Star Wars standalone films, 'Rogue One: A Star Wars Story,' an all-new epic adventure. In a time of conflict, a group of unlikely heroes band together on a mission to steal the plans to the Death Star, the Empire's ultimate weapon of destruction. This key event in the Star Warstimeline brings together ordinary people who choose to do extraordinary things, and in doing so, become part of something greater than themselves. 'Rogue One: A Star Wars Story' is directed by Gareth Edwards and stars Felicity Jones, Diego Luna, Ben Mendelsohn, Donnie Yen, Mads Mikkelsen, Alan Tudyk, Riz Ahmed, with Jiang Wen and Forest Whitaker. Kathleen Kennedy, Allison Shearmur and Simon Emanuel are producing, with John Knoll and Jason McGatlin serving as executive producers. 'Rogue One: A Star Wars Story' opens in U.S. theaters on December 16, 2016.
